Hernia Repair Surgery in Hawaii: What to Know

Hawaii offers excellent options for hernia repair, particularly at The Queen's Medical Center in Honolulu. Their dedicated Hernia Center provides a multidisciplinary approach, utilizing general, plastic, and trauma surgeons for complex cases. East Hawaii Health and Hawaii Pacific Health facilities like Pali Momi also leverage robotic-assisted techniques, which can lead to lower post-operative complications and quicker recovery times.

For potentially lower costs and faster recovery, consider Ambulatory Surgery Centers (ASCs) such as Minimally Invasive Surgery of Hawaii, which offer outpatient hernia repair. Traveling to an ASC within Hawaii can provide a more comfortable and less anxious environment for your procedure. Verify current pricing directly with providers.

What should I expect to pay for hernia repair surgery in Hawaii?
In Hawaii, hernia repair surgery runs about $8,148 on average. Most patients pay between $3,492 and $17,460, with the final price shaped by your choice of surgeon, facility type, and procedure complexity.
Why are hernia repair surgery prices higher in Hawaii?
Hawaii's elevated hernia repair surgery costs reflect broader economic factors. The state's cost of living index (116.4) drives up overhead for medical practices, and that cost gets passed through to patients — resulting in prices 16.4% above the national benchmark.
Can I use insurance for hernia repair surgery in Hawaii?
Yes — hernia repair surgery is generally covered by insurance in Hawaii when your doctor documents medical necessity. Expect to pay your deductible and copay, but the bulk of the $8,148 cost should be covered by your plan.
What's the recovery time for hernia repair surgery?
Most Hawaii patients need 7 to 42 days to fully recover from hernia repair surgery. Your surgeon will schedule follow-ups during this window to monitor healing. At Hawaii's cost of living (RPP 116.4), lost wages during recovery can be a significant hidden cost — budget for that alongside the procedure itself.
Are payment plans available for hernia repair surgery in Hawaii?
You have several options to cover the $8,148 average in Hawaii. Third-party financing (CareCredit, Alphaeon) offers 0% intro APR periods up to 24 months. Many surgeons also accept direct payment plans or offer discounts of 10-20% for paying in full upfront.
How do I choose a hernia repair surgery facility in Hawaii?
Compare facilities on volume (higher volume correlates with better outcomes), accreditation status, and the negotiated rate vs. what you'd pay out of pocket. In Hawaii, check whether an outpatient surgery center can perform your hernia repair surgery — ASCs typically charge 30-50% less than hospitals for the same procedure.
Is hernia repair surgery covered under Hawaii's Medicaid program?
Medicaid coverage for hernia repair surgery in Hawaii depends on medical necessity. If your doctor documents that hernia repair surgery is required for your health, Hawaii Medicaid may cover part or all of the cost. Pre-authorization is typically required. Contact Hawaii's Medicaid office or your managed care plan for specific coverage details.

How we calculate hernia repair surgery costs in Hawaii

Cost estimates combine procedure-specific pricing data with regional cost-of-living and provider-supply adjustments. Primary sources:

  • Hospital pricing transparency files — CMS-required machine-readable data published by hospitals under the CMS Hospital Price Transparency rule (effective January 2021). Provides actual negotiated rates between hospitals and insurers.
  • HCUP (Healthcare Cost & Utilization Project)AHRQ's HCUP databases provide nationally-representative procedure cost data by state, payer, and patient demographics.
  • Bureau of Labor Statistics — Healthcare Practitioner Occupational WagesBLS OEWS data on surgeon, anesthesiologist, and surgical staff wages by state, used to model regional labor-cost differences in procedure pricing.
  • BEA Regional Price Parities (RPP)U.S. Bureau of Economic Analysis state-level price-level indices, used to adjust national procedure averages for Hawaii's cost-of-living relative to the national mean.
  • FAIR Health Consumer Cost Lookup — the FAIR Health database aggregates billed and allowed amounts from over 36 billion claim records, providing a check on procedure-cost ranges by ZIP code.
  • Medicare Provider Utilization & Payment DataCMS public-use files on Medicare-allowed amounts and submitted charges by HCPCS/CPT code and state, used as a baseline for procedure-cost ranges.

Estimates are illustrative and reflect typical pricing ranges; actual costs depend on insurance coverage, surgical complexity, anesthesia type, hospital vs. ambulatory setting, and individual patient factors.
